To render bitumen or asphalt binder appropriate for special calls for, such as road pavement, it is typically combined with polymers to kind a so-referred to as polymer-modified bitumen . Compared to widespread bitumen, PMB is extra cohesive to mineral particles, and the temperature vary between the softening point and the verge of Bitumen RC30 supplier collapse is wider. It shows better structural recovery after load removing and is extra resistant to material fatigue. Furthermore, PMB shows higher water resistance in addition to higher rigidity and sturdiness.

Canadian "bitumen" supply is extra loosely accepted as manufacturing from the Athabasca, Wabasca, Peace River and Cold Lake oil-sands deposits. The majority of the oil produced from these deposits has an API gravity of between 8° and 12° and a reservoir viscosity of over 10,000 centipoise although small volumes have higher API gravities and decrease viscosities. The vast majority of bitumen utilized in asphalt for road development is typical bitumen; that's the reason it is usually generally known as paving grade. The time period ‘pen grade’ is short for penetration grade, and displays the truth that this kind of product is commonly categorized utilizing the penetration test. The time period straight run refers to the fact that this kind of bitumen is commonly produced directly from the vacuum distillation course of, without any additional modification. The most manufacturing type of bitumen in the world is petroleum bitumen which is obtained from crude oil distillation and they're classified based on Penetration Grade (normal ASTM-D5).

Neither of the terms "asphalt" or "bitumen" ought to be confused with tar or coal tars. Tar is the thick liquid product of the dry distillation and pyrolysis of organic hydrocarbons primarily sourced from vegetation masses bitumen manufacturers, whether fossilized as with coal, or freshly harvested. Bitumen, and coal using the Bergius process, may be refined into petrols corresponding to gasoline, and bitumen may be distilled into tar, not the other method around.
